Austria to Repeat Presidential Vote Oct. 2 After Court Decision

(Bloomberg) -- Austria will repeat its presidential election on Oct. 2, Chancellor Christian Kern told reporters in Vienna on Tuesday following a weekly ministerial meeting.

The new vote follows Friday's Constitutional Court ruling that upheld the nationalist Freedom Party's challenge to the May 22 runoff election. Freedom's Norbert Hofer, lost the election to Alexander Van der Bellen by slightly more than 30,000 votes out of more than 4.5 million cast.
